California Awards APD Traffic Safety Grant

Dec 03,2020

Money to fund increased safety patrols

California Office of Traffic Safety has awarded a $370,000 grant to the Alameda Police Department (APD).

The grant will assist APD in its efforts to reduce deaths and injuries while increasing roadway safety on city streets.

Rash of Shootings Plague Island City

Oct 06,2020

Last Saturday’s gunfire increases city’s number to 11 since June 1

Another shooting incident took place in Alameda on Saturday, Oct. 3, adding to an already alarming increase in shooting incidents on the Island in the past several months.

APD Officers Arrest Shooter

Sep 22,2020

An Alameda man was arrested for aggravated assault with a deadly weapon on Wednesday, Sept. 16 for allegedly shooting a woman in the leg the same day in the parking lot of Mountain Mike’s Pizza at 714 Central Ave.
